#43ed4e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#43ed4e is composed of 26.3% red, 92.9%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.1%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 123.9 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 59.6%. #43ed4e color hex could be obtained by blending #86ff9c with #00db00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#43ed4e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010901 is the darkest color, while #f6fef7 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#43ed4e is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#a8a8a8 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#94b696 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#e9d14f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ffc86d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#80dfef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#acdb4e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#bad562 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#6ae4b4 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
